隨著物聯網、人工智能和智能硬件的飛速發展,嵌入式軟件開發已成為當前科技行業中最具前景的職業方向之一。嵌入式系統作為各種智能設備的核心,其開發技術培訓也日益受到關注。
嵌入式軟件開發培訓主要涵蓋以下核心內容:
學員需要掌握C/C++編程語言,這是嵌入式開發的基礎。相比其他編程領域,嵌入式開發對代碼的效率、穩定性和資源占用有更高要求。培訓課程通常會從基礎語法講起,逐步深入到指針操作、內存管理和數據結構等進階內容。
硬件知識是嵌入式開發不可或缺的部分。培訓內容包括微控制器架構、處理器原理、外圍設備接口等。學員需要了解常見的嵌入式平臺,如ARM、AVR、MIPS等架構,并掌握如何通過編程控制GPIO、UART、I2C、SPI等接口。
操作系統原理也是培訓重點。除了裸機編程外,學員還需要學習實時操作系統(RTOS)的使用,如FreeRTOS、uC/OS等。這些系統能夠提供任務調度、內存管理和設備驅動等核心功能,是開發復雜嵌入式系統的必備工具。
在實際項目訓練方面,培訓機構通常會安排多個實戰項目,包括:
通過這些項目,學員能夠將理論知識轉化為實際開發能力,積累項目經驗。
值得一提的是,優秀的嵌入式開發工程師還需要具備良好的調試技能。培訓課程會教授如何使用示波器、邏輯分析儀等硬件調試工具,以及GDB等軟件調試工具,幫助學員快速定位和解決問題。
隨著5G技術和邊緣計算的興起,嵌入式開發領域也在不斷演進。現代嵌入式開發培訓已經開始融入Linux系統編程、網絡協議、人工智能算法部署等新興內容,以適應行業發展的需求。
對于想要進入這個領域的學員而言,選擇合適的培訓機構至關重要。優秀的培訓課程不僅提供完整的知識體系,還會注重培養學員的工程思維和解決問題的能力。同時,許多機構還會提供就業指導服務,幫助學員順利進入心儀的企業。
嵌入式軟件開發培訓是進入高科技行業的重要途徑。通過系統化的學習,學員能夠掌握從硬件控制到軟件開發的完整技能鏈條,為未來的職業發展奠定堅實基礎。在這個萬物互聯的時代,嵌入式開發技能將成為越來越寶貴的核心競爭力。
如若轉載,請注明出處:http://www.smjtjs.cn/product/1.html
更新時間:2026-01-12 19:31:36
PRODUCT